If you want to earn a beauty certification, or perhaps obtain a certificate in a particular area of cosmetology, the following is how to go about doing it. In order to get licensed or certified in Michigan, you have to completely finish your own formal education to start with.
After that, remember to go to the necessary 1500 hrs to meet the requirements of the Michigan Board of Cosmetology. Through this vital time you will surely get hands on education like you will perform at your future workplace.
The next step in the process is to successfully pass the state’s licensing examination. Remember to try to find apprenticeship programs, they will get you more hours when it comes to your training and get prospects for potential future employment.
It is also critical to think about, after you have been registered, you will have to re-up your license. Visit your Board of Cosmetology to get renewal prerequisites.
MI Licensing Hours for Jobs Accessible Inside of the Beauty Field
- Hairdresser – 2000 Working hrs
- Esthetician – 400 Working hrs and Six mo. with regards to Alternatives Apprenticeship Opportunities
- Nail Technician – 1500 Hrs together with 6 months’ with regards to Opportunities Apprenticeships Programs
- Electrologist – 1500 Work hrs together with 6 months time intended for Programs Apprenticeship Options available
- Masseuse – 500 Working hours

Career and Income Outlook
Cosmetologist Positions in Temperance MI
National Details | Data from www.bls.gov |
---|---|
Median Pay Per Year | $22,770 per year |
Median Pay Per Hr | 10.95 an hr |
Measure of Education to begin | Post-Secondary non degree award |
Work Experience | NA |
Job Training | NA |
Number of Positions in the Year 2012 | 663,300 |
Occupational Prospects Growth, 2012-22 | +13% |
Job Opportunities Increase through 2022 | + 83,300 |
Per the O*Net Online, beauticians are highly in demand in the State of Michigan. With the expected significant growth over the next decade, there should be lots of jobs that you can pick from. In the event beauty training centers say they provide full cosmetology training programs, it usually implies the training involving hair-styling, natual skin care, nail-care, and make up is actually to be found in one broad course.
Beauty Schools Instruct College Students Quite a Number of Attributes to use
Beauty college students discover ways to utilize the knowledge acquired for clients as a result of group class lessons, the provided guides, as well as hands on real life training, practicing in salons for students only.
A certified program curriculum will be different from state to state, however a cosmetology school enrolee ought to graduate from their course having a deep understanding of every section of the beautician field, although individuals are definitely able to focus on a certain area or service.
